The conservative opposition leader Friedrich Merz has won Germany's general election, but he will need to form a coalition to govern as chancellor.
Merz's conservative bloc has received around 28 percent of the vote, the largest in the German parliament.
And far-right Alternative for Germany has emerged as the second largest.
It's the best result for a far-right party there, since the World War II.

Al Jazeera’s Dominic Kane reports from Berlin, Germany.
